Dependent Failure Analysis (DFA) is a safety analysis process described in ISO 26262 Element 9, Clause seven that identifies and evaluates failures that are not statistically impartial – where by a single root trigger can concurrently have an affect on several features assumed for being impartial, perhaps defeating the redundancy and security mechanisms on which the safety idea depends.
A CAN transceiver failure in dominant mode blocks all CAN interaction – blocking protection-relevant diagnostic messages from being transmitted by other ECUs on the same bus.
FFI is needed for coexistence of features with different ASILs on the identical components (e.g., QM and ASIL D software on the exact same MCU – addressed by means of AUTOSAR partitioning). Independence is required for ASIL decomposition – in which two factors should be adequately independent for that decomposed ASIL to be valid.
However, if a common root bring about can trigger equally failures, the merged chance results in website being much higher – equivalent to your probability of The one root cause taking place. This dramatically enhances the danger of security objective violation compared to what the impartial failure calculation predicts.

The cascading failure analysis examines how a fault in a single factor can propagate to a different. For each interface amongst things from the pair, the analysis evaluates what failure modes of factor A could propagate through the interface to result in a failure in aspect B, whether safety barriers exist to have the fault inside aspect A, and just what the consequence of fault propagation could well be on the safety function.
